Unleashing the Potential of Kashmir’s Hospitality Industry

Kashmir, which is tucked away in the stunning northern Indian terrain, is well known for its amazing beauty, depth of culture, and kind people. Over the years, the area has developed into a popular choice for tourists looking for a unique combination of natural beauty and cultural immersion. With its potential and expansion occurring at a critical juncture, Kashmir’s hotel sector has been essential in forming the region’s character. The customs of hospitality in Kashmir are centuries old and ingrained in the cultural fabric of the area. The region’s attraction has always been derived from the renowned kindness and hospitality of the Kashmiri people, which makes it a popular travel destination. Kashmir’s long history of hospitality is exemplified by the renowned houseboat trips on Dal Lake as well as the custom of residents welcoming guests into their homes, which embodies the idea that “Atithi Devo Bhava”—that is, the guest is God.

 

The hospitality sector in Kashmir has experienced significant expansion and modernization in recent years, resulting in a profound transformation. The range of services has increased, from the age-old shikara walas traversing the calm rivers to the modern hotel proprietors utilizing cutting-edge facilities. At every level, there is a discernible surge in investments, indicating a shared dedication to realizing the industry’s potential. The hospitality industry in Kashmir has a dynamic and varied investment landscape. People from diverse backgrounds, including dhaba owners, shopkeepers, travel brokers, hotel owners, drivers, shikara operators, and pony handlers, are actively investing in the industry. This liberalization of investment highlights the inclusive expansion of the sector while also guaranteeing broad economic advantages.

 

Shikaras and ponies, two traditional forms of transportation, are inextricably linked to the Kashmiri experience. Shikara owners who ply the serene waters of Dal Lake are seeing an influx of capital allocated to the upkeep and improvement of their vessels. Pony handlers, who offer a distinctive kind of transportation in hilly areas, are also improving their offerings to meet the changing needs of contemporary tourists. The transportation system and local restaurants are the foundation of every successful tourism industry. Drivers in Kashmir are seeing more investments made in their cars and services, whether they are escorting visitors through the picturesque roads or making sure airport transfers go well. In addition to serving authentic Kashmiri food, dhaba proprietors are updating their spaces to appeal to a more affluent clientele.

 

The vivid handicrafts and native treasures adorning Kashmir’s busy markets make it a shoppers’ dream. Retailers are allocating resources into augmenting their stock, guaranteeing a varied assortment of goods for travelers. In order to improve their services and reach a wider audience, travel agencies are simultaneously investing in technology and marketing. Travel agents play a vital role as middlemen between tourists and the region’s attractions. The lodging options offered by the hospitality sector are its core component. To reach international standards, hotel operators in Kashmir are investing heavily on amenities, infrastructure, and service quality. Greater investments in training and skill development are also helping the workforce in these establishments—from housekeeping to managerial personnel—ensuring a higher standard of professionalism and customer satisfaction. Not only is the hotel business changing due to the explosion of investments in its various parts, but the local economy is also benefiting from this good economic catalyst. The increased demand for tourism-related goods and services is opening up new revenue streams for regional suppliers, artisans, and service providers, strengthening and fortifying the local economy.

 

Although the hospitality industry in Kashmir is expanding and receiving investments, there are still difficulties. Among the challenges faced by stakeholders are infrastructure limitations, seasonal changes, and geopolitical issues. Nonetheless, these obstacles also offer chances for creative fixes and calculated teamwork. Investigating ways to overcome obstacles and further develop the industry’s potential includes using digital platforms for marketing, community participation, and sustainable tourism practices. Sustainable tourism is essential in Kashmir because of its delicate ecological and rich cultural legacy. The tourism industry have the capacity to set the standard for responsible tourism through the adoption of environmentally conscious measures, the promotion of regional handicrafts, and the advocacy for the conservation of natural resources. In addition to securing the industry’s long-term survival, sustainable tourism strengthens ties between travelers and the place they are visiting.

 

Cultural Intelligence (CQ) – potentially game-changing element

In the diverse hospitality sector of Kashmir, whereby friendliness and cultural immersion are essential, the incorporation of Cultural Intelligence (CQ) among personnel holds the potential to revolutionize business norms. Fostering a greater knowledge and appreciation of other cultures becomes increasingly important as the region experiences a spike in investments and tourists. The ability to successfully traverse and understand cultural differences is referred to as cultural intelligence. In the context of Kashmir’s hospitality industry, this means not just recognizing the many backgrounds of guests but also giving the local labor force the tools necessary to adapt and interact with people from different cultural backgrounds. This extends beyond language skills and includes knowledge of the subtleties, norms, and traditions that add to a visitor’s feeling of familiarity and community.

 

Employees in the hotel industry in Kashmir who possess Cultural Intelligence have the potential to greatly improve the visitor experience. Positive and lasting impressions are created when guests feel appreciated and understood for their cultural choices. Culturally aware staff members are able to anticipate the demands of a wide range of visitors, resulting in a more enjoyable and customized stay. These small gestures, which can include acknowledging dietary restrictions, honoring cultural holidays, or providing information about regional customs, go a long way toward making a guest feel truly welcomed. Kashmir draws tourists from all over the world because of its rich history and varied cultures. When cultural intelligence is incorporated into the workplace, it creates a culture where workers are empowered to represent their culture. This fosters harmony and inclusivity while also bridging gaps between various populations. Workers with cultural intelligence can foster meaningful relationships, impart knowledge about regional traditions, and advance intercultural understanding. As a result, the hospitality industry starts to encourage cross-cultural understanding and communication.

 

Cultural intelligence infuses every facet of service delivery and is not limited to interactions with guests. A team that possesses cultural intelligence is aware of the different tastes and sensitivities of its customers, from room configurations to menu options. By ensuring that services are customized to each visitor’s needs, this degree of awareness makes the whole trip more pleasurable and welcoming to visitors from different cultural backgrounds. Initiatives for training and development are essential for integrating Cultural Intelligence in an efficient manner. Kashmiri hospitality businesses can fund initiatives that teach staff members about many cultures, provide abilities to communicate across cultures, and foster cultural sensitivity. These kinds of programs enable employees to easily adjust to changing demands from a wide range of clients. Employee skill sets can be further improved by offering language instruction and opportunities for cultural immersion, which will improve their ability to interact with visitors from around the globe.

 

Redefining the dynamics of the hotel industry in Kashmir can be achieved by strategically incorporating Cultural Intelligence into the workforce. The ability of staff to deal with cultural differences will be a critical differentiator as the area draws in more and more international visitors. The hospitality sector in Kashmir may further cement its standing as an inclusive and hospitable travel destination by improving the visitor experience, fostering cross-cultural understanding and advocating for a culturally aware approach to service delivery. By means of deliberate training programs and a dedication to diversity, the industry can use the transforming potential of Cultural Intelligence, guaranteeing a peaceful and stimulating experience for guests from around the globe.
